Apple's chorus of critics: How wrong can they be?

By any rational standard, Apple is simply killing it. It sucks up more than nine out of every 10 dollars of profit earned by smartphone makers, is on the verge of passing its only credible rival in phone sales, has built a leading position in the Chinese market, and is returning cash to investors. So why are pundits unhappy?
